The cheapest way to get from Havant to Titchfield is to drive which costs £3 - £5 and takes 16 min.
The fastest way to get from Havant to Titchfield is to taxi which takes 16 min and costs £29 - £35.
No, there is no direct bus from Havant station to Titchfield.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at The Square via International Port.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 9m.
The distance between Havant and Titchfield is 12 miles. The road distance is 13 miles.
The best way to get from Havant to Titchfield without a car is to train and bus which takes 32 min and costs £7 - £13.
It takes approximately 32 min to get from Havant to Titchfield, including transfers.
Havant to Titchfield bus services, operated by Stagecoach South, depart from Bus Station.
Havant to Titchfield bus services, operated by Stagecoach South, arrive at Estella Road station.
Yes, the driving distance between Havant to Titchfield is 13 miles. It takes approximately 16 min to drive from Havant to Titchfield.
